Настройка отображения заданий

Напишите нам, если не нашли ответ в Справке. Вы можете приложить скриншоты или видео, чтобы ускорить помощь:

Написать в чат  Написать в Telegram

Для управления настройками отображения заданий на странице используйте плагин plugin.toloka:

{
  "type": "plugin.toloka",
  "layout": {
    "kind": "scroll",
    "taskWidth": 300,
    "background": "pink"
  }
}

Способы отображения задаются в свойстве kind:

  • scroll (по умолчанию) — отображать несколько заданий на странице одновременно.
  • pager — отображать на странице только одно задание, но внизу под заданием будет переключатель между заданиями.

С помощью свойства taskWidth вы можете настроить ширину задания. По умолчанию задание отображается на полный экран.

С помощью свойства background вы можете установить цветной фон заданий. Это позволит исполнителю визуально отличать задания в процессе выполнения страницы заданий.

Примеры

Расположить несколько заданий в ряд

Допустим, вы хотите отображать по 2 задания в каждой строке на экране. Для этого поставьте значение taskWidth таким, чтобы на большинстве экранов у исполнителей помещалось 2 задания. Например, укажите значение 500, чтобы на всех экранах с шириной больше 1000 пикселей отображалось по 2 задания. В свойстве kind значение scroll.

Показывать одно задание из нескольких

Вы можете показывать только одно задание из нескольких, а внизу добавить переключатель. Для этого в свойстве kind укажите значение pager. Если не задавать ширину задания, то оно будет развернуто на полный экран.

Настроить цветной фон задания

Допустим, вы хотите установить цветной фон задания, чтобы оно отличалось от других на странице заданий.

Для этого укажите значение свойства background одним из способов:

Укажите в background цвет фона в виде строки.

Примечание

Свойство background может принимать значения, которые доступны в background-color.

  1. Укажите в background объект с двумя свойствами:

    • type — тип данных;
    • path — название входного поля.
  2. Укажите цвет фона во входных данных.

Написать в службу поддержки